Understanding Last Mile Delivery: The Critical Link

Last mile delivery refers to the final step of the delivery process from a distribution hub to the end user. While it covers the shortest distance in the entire supply chain, it’s disproportionately complex and expensive, often accounting for more than 50% of total shipping costs. It’s the moment of truth where a customer’s anticipation meets reality.

What Defines the Last Mile?

The “last mile” isn’t always literally one mile. It encompasses various scenarios, including:

    • E-commerce to Residence: Delivering packages from online orders directly to a consumer’s home.
    • Business-to-Business (B2B): Transporting goods from a supplier to a business location, often with specific time windows.
    • Food & Grocery Delivery: Expeditious delivery of perishable items from restaurants or stores to customers.
    • Medical & Pharmaceutical: Urgent and secure delivery of sensitive goods, often temperature-controlled.

Key Challenges in Last Mile Delivery

Despite its importance, the last mile is fraught with challenges that can impede efficiency and escalate costs. Navigating these obstacles is essential for successful delivery operations.

High Operational Costs

The fragmented nature of last mile delivery makes it inherently expensive:

    • Fuel & Labor: Multiple stops, varying distances, and urban congestion lead to high fuel consumption and driver wages.
    • Vehicle Maintenance: Frequent stop-and-go driving, especially in urban areas, puts significant wear and tear on vehicles.
    • Failed Deliveries: If a customer isn’t home, redelivery attempts double the cost and waste valuable resources.

Example: A delivery driver attempting to deliver 100 packages across a sprawling city might spend more time idling in traffic or searching for parking than actually delivering. If 10% of those deliveries fail due to customer unavailability, it adds considerable expense for redelivery routes.

Inefficiency and Route Optimization Complexities

Planning the most efficient routes for numerous packages to various destinations is a monumental task:

    • Traffic Congestion: Urban traffic can unpredictably delay deliveries, impacting schedules and increasing fuel use.
    • Dynamic Demands: Sudden changes in order volumes, customer requests, or road conditions require agile route adjustments.
    • Geographic Challenges: Navigating complex building layouts, gated communities, or rural areas without clear addresses adds significant time.

Technologies Revolutionizing Last Mile Delivery

Technological innovation is at the forefront of tackling last mile challenges, offering solutions that enhance efficiency, reduce costs, and improve the customer experience.

Advanced Route Optimization Software

These sophisticated tools use algorithms to calculate the most efficient delivery routes, considering variables like traffic, delivery windows, vehicle capacity, and driver availability.

    • Dynamic Routing: Adjusts routes in real-time based on new orders, cancellations, or traffic updates.
    • Multi-Stop Optimization: Plans the optimal sequence of stops for multiple drivers and vehicles.

Practical Example: A courier company using route optimization software can reduce its fuel consumption by 15-20% and complete 25% more deliveries per driver per day by eliminating unnecessary miles and idle time.

Real-time Tracking and Visibility

GPS-enabled tracking provides complete visibility for both businesses and customers.

    • For Businesses: Monitor driver locations, progress, and identify potential delays.
    • For Customers: Track their package’s journey from dispatch to delivery, often with estimated arrival times.

Benefits: Reduces “where is my order?” calls, builds customer trust, and allows for proactive issue resolution.

AI and Machine Learning

AI is transforming last mile logistics by processing vast amounts of data to make intelligent predictions and decisions.

    • Demand Forecasting: Predicts future order volumes to optimize staffing and fleet size.
    • Predictive Maintenance: Analyzes vehicle data to anticipate maintenance needs, preventing breakdowns.
    • Optimized Packing: Recommends optimal package sizes and loading strategies.

Autonomous Delivery Solutions

While still emerging, autonomous technologies promise future disruption:

    • Delivery Robots: Small, sidewalk-bound robots for short-distance, local deliveries in urban environments.
    • Delivery Drones: Aerial vehicles ideal for rapid, direct deliveries in less congested areas, especially for urgent or high-value items.
    • Autonomous Vehicles: Self-driving vans or trucks for longer hauls to a micro-fulfillment center, or eventually, direct to consumer.

Strategies for Optimizing Last Mile Operations

Implementing the right strategies, often leveraging the technologies mentioned above, can significantly enhance efficiency and customer satisfaction in last mile delivery.

Centralized Delivery Management Platforms

These platforms integrate various aspects of delivery operations into a single dashboard, providing end-to-end visibility and control.

    • Order Aggregation: Combines orders from multiple channels.
    • Driver Management: Assigns routes, tracks performance, and communicates with drivers.
    • Customer Communication: Automates notifications and provides tracking links.
    • Reporting & Analytics: Offers insights into delivery performance, costs, and areas for improvement.

Practical Example: A furniture retailer can use a platform to manage all deliveries, from scheduling white-glove assembly services to coordinating with customers for specific drop-off times, all while tracking driver progress in real-time.

Effective Fleet Management and Diversification

Optimizing your fleet goes beyond just route planning:

    • Vehicle Selection: Choosing the right vehicle size and type for different delivery needs (e.g., bikes for dense urban areas, vans for larger orders).
    • Maintenance Schedules: Proactive maintenance to minimize downtime and extend vehicle lifespan.
    • Driver Training: Equipping drivers with efficient driving techniques, customer service skills, and technology proficiency.
    • Eco-friendly Options: Investing in electric vehicles (EVs), e-bikes, or walking couriers to reduce carbon footprint and operating costs.

Proactive Customer Communication

Keeping customers informed significantly reduces anxiety and the likelihood of failed deliveries.

    • Automated Notifications: SMS or email updates at dispatch, en route, and upon arrival.
    • Real-time Tracking Links: Allowing customers to follow their package’s journey.
    • Estimated Time of Arrival (ETA): Providing accurate, dynamic ETAs.
    • Feedback Channels: Allowing customers to provide delivery feedback for continuous improvement.

Leveraging Micro-fulfillment Centers and Lockers

Bringing inventory closer to the customer reduces the distance of the last mile.

    • Micro-fulfillment Centers (MFCs): Small, automated warehouses strategically located in urban areas for rapid order fulfillment.
    • Pickup/Drop-off (PUDO) Points: Network of convenience stores, lockers, or designated retail locations where customers can pick up or drop off packages at their convenience.

Benefits: Reduces transportation costs, speeds up delivery times, and offers greater flexibility to customers who may not be home for direct delivery.

The Future of Last Mile Delivery

The landscape of last mile delivery is continuously evolving, driven by technological advancements, shifting consumer behaviors, and a growing emphasis on sustainability. The future promises even more dynamic and personalized solutions.

Hyper-Personalization and Convenience

Customers will increasingly expect highly tailored delivery experiences:

    • Scheduled Windows: More precise, shorter delivery windows chosen by the customer.
    • In-Home/In-Car Delivery: Secure delivery directly into a customer’s home (e.g., smart lock integration) or vehicle trunk.
    • Subscription Models: Prime-like services offering unlimited deliveries for a fee.

Sustainable Delivery Solutions

Environmental concerns will push for greener logistics:

    • Electric Fleets: Widespread adoption of electric vehicles, bikes, and scooters for urban deliveries.
    • Consolidated Deliveries: Optimizing routes to minimize trips and maximize vehicle capacity.
    • Packaging Innovation: Sustainable, reusable, or minimal packaging to reduce waste.
    • Alternative Modes: Increased use of cargo bikes, walking couriers, and potentially drone networks in specific zones.

Enhanced Integration and Collaboration

The last mile will become more interconnected:

    • API Integrations: Seamless data exchange between e-commerce platforms, delivery management systems, and third-party logistics providers.
    • Crowdsourced Delivery: Leveraging a network of independent contractors or gig workers for flexible, on-demand delivery capacity, especially during peak times.
    • Logistics-as-a-Service (LaaS): Companies offering comprehensive last mile solutions to businesses of all sizes, often including technology, fleet, and drivers.
